    Thankyou Brian.

    I am pretty much finished now with the mechanical build, I had three major set backs during the build.

    1) I only ordered 1 250mm C-Beams using the Bill of Materials and should have ordered 3.... I didnt triple check the order so my fault.

    2) I sourced the lead screws from a local supplier here in Australia but didnt realise their nominal supplied length is 20 ~ 30mm shorter than what openbuilds supllies, simply due to the fact they dont currently supply C-Beam or the thick C-Beam end plates so they don't account for it.
    This meant I had to cut my original 1010mm leadscrew to make 1 x 540mm and re-order a new 1040mm and another 540mm from openbuilds, the 300mm from the aussie supplier worked fine for the Z axes, as openbuilds would have been 290mm.
    I thought makerstore might offer a credit but they didnt, I didnt ask for one but did advise of my situation.... not to worry though this is how one learns to check and cross check things more thoroughly next time and it was certainly not makerstores fault either.
    It is something that as a first timer is very easy to overlook.

    3)In my second order with correct size lead screws and 250mm C- Beams I also ordered my 4 high torque Nema 23 motors but one of them was faulty from manufacture, the shaft was displaced by about 10mm and very hard to turn, it certainly wasnt damaged in transit either.
    But a quick PM to Mark to find out how to place a warranty claim and the parts team confirmed a new motor shipped out to me literally within 30Minutes of initial contact. The motor arrived here in Australia at my PO Box within 6 days of that email.

    Hi Bill,

    you will have a lot of fun and get some real satisfaction putting this kit together. Be sure things are squared up properly as you build and take your time.

    I didn't follow the build manual precisely as I was missing some bits here and there due to me mis ordering from the BOM but everything still came together really easilly so you shouldn't have any problems.

    I might suggest to file a flat spot on the lead screws so the grub screws on the collars screw in a bit further, I did have a little issue with them hitting the adjacent beams as they rotate, there is not much clearance there.... it will make more sense once you assemble yours, I recall Brady having the same issue during his live build but he didn't say what he did to fix the problem, I think he had an internet outage around that time of the build.

    I am going to give a GRBL shield a go with some DQ542's , so I will be using the shield as a breakout board to the DQ's....I was going to do the Gecko's but thought seeing as OB sell the DQ's they must be good, so am prepared to give them a go.

    If you are going GRBL with an Arduino solution you will need external drivers due to the fact the high torque motors need more current to run effeciently. Thats what I have read around the traps anyhow.

    Thanks @Moag,

    I Am currently fiddling and farting around with MACH3 on Windows 7 32Bit....I am really starting to feel, while MACH3 might have been the program to use in it's day back with Windows XP and is ETREMELY Versatile from a configuration/customisation perspective, I think there are better choices these days, but I did want to investigate MACH3 as I have mentioned elsewhere.

    I am having issues just trying to do a Pen Plot at the moment, I am getting plots OK but not perfect ones.
    Admittedly I am getting flex & movement in the pen holder, which I am finding difficult to perfect but I can also hear that the steppers are intermittently not running smoothly, I am 100% certain that MACH3 is being interfered with by background processes, I can also see this on the diagnostic screen. Just jogging, I can hear changes in the motor, sometimes even a consistent knocking like sound, that can be on all Axis too, so it's not the motors and not mechanical, other times it will jog smoothly.

    I have been reading many people actually go back to Windows XP and it works great. Although this is a step backwards I might do just that just to see if that really is the problem just out of curiosity.

    I am using Parallel as the BOB was thrown in with the Drivers as a freebee, Now I know why !!
    I believe purchasing an Ethernet Smooth Stepper will also fix the problem but I think I will try the XP route first and I still have the Arduino GRBL option sitting here untested.

    @Moag, Very Nice setup there... I like the camera Idea.

    I have Raspberry's here too, I am a PC Support Tech so I have lots of Technology surrounding me in the workshop and can experiment with different platforms at a whim, But I want to get something going rock solid first as I have not done this before.

    I am actually a Radio Tech by trade and fairly experienced with RF and interference problems, but have been involved with PC Technology since Mid 80's, yes IBM PC/AT era.

    I am running shielded cable from the BOB to the Drivers and have fitted RF Chokes to the Stepper Cables, I doubt that interference would be picked up on the driver output lines, I am running at 48V to the motors.
    The Most likely place any interference would take place is on the TTL (5V) lines on the driver input lines or in the drivers themselves on the low voltage side of things but they are fairly well shielded.

    I really think it's this clunky old MACH3, probably a bad choice to start off with but I have been learning a lot of CNC Jargon etc. by playing around with it and I am not the only one that has these issues, I have also read today that MACH3 and MACH4 round off square corners instead of actually following the cutting path, very much related to acceleration settings in the motor tuning area.     I made a discovery playing around a bit last night.... MACH3/WIN7 with a Parallel port just SUCKS !!

    I had not really tried anything except fiddle with different settings in MACH3 and then try another run and just let the machine do its thing but what I discovered last night was that if I go to the tool path window and click around, zoom in and out I can hear the motors doing the clunk sounds as I am mousing around, so then I thought well what happens if I do something really stupid and open up Windows Control Panel while a Job is in progress.....

    Well that causes all sorts of Motor Sound changes, obviously the Pulse train is critically effected by even the slightest interruption to the program, and I don't care what anyone says, I reckon it is a poorly written program and not real good at all to be effected in such a way.

    Maybe the Author was utilising the Parallel port in such a way that was never intended using interrupts etc. and if these issues could not be overcome, then the program should never have been sold as a commercial piece of code due to it's inherent instability, anyhow that's my personal feelings and I am sure there are many people out there that will flame me for the above statement but if I were to produce a program with issues like that then I would not market it, if it is purely a printer port hardware issue/limitation, then drop the support for a printer port all together and only support what is stable.

    I am well aware of the Windows Guide to Optimisation of MACH3 but the lengths you have to go to are simply ridiculous in my opinion and you should not have to go to those lengths to make a program perform correctly for it's basic job.

    I suspect this would be causing lost steps and all sorts of problems.

    This means ANY background activity carried out by windows drivers or background processes will cause issues.
    This explains why I sometimes hear the motors run smooth and then not so smooth with funny little clunks, sometimes random and sometimes perfectly timed like a consistent knock, it actually sound like a mechanical fault at times, I also hear a different pitch/whine and then they come back to a nice steady correct sound again.

    However today I got a pretty good plot of the OX Plate Pen example, as you can see I still have not perfected my pen holder and there is still some lateral movement causing the circles to look a little funny but good enough to see that things are working properly.
    I also did not have the pen down against the paper enough hence some missing lines but the plot looks like what it should this time.

    So yes I am getting there.

    This plot was Velocity 250mm/Min and Acceleration 6.25mm/sec/sec

    20161103_012817.jpg

    Here is my Pen holder that I am still trying to perfect, its just some 20mm and 16mm conduits, a spring and Electrical tape to jam the pen in snug, the 16mm conduit fits beautifully into the 20mm, some sanding was necessary and some talcon powder as a dry lube.

    20161103_014126.jpg

    20161103_015920.jpg

    The spring tension is something I am trying to get right.

    So the 16mm Conduit slides in and out of the 20mm conduit, the pen is jammed into the 16mm Conduit with electrical tape to make the pen just the right thickness to snug in there.
    There is a Spring inside the 20mm Joiner with the 20mm End cap at the top that works against the pen keeping it against the paper.

    I think I have too much spring tension and this caused the pen to really dig in and drag along causing deflection, a lighter touch would be better....     of course you can. The content is G-code, plain text, and the name.ext does not matter at all (except to windows that tries to identify files by the extension rather than content)
    go into MDI mode and issue the command 'G61'.
    those rounded corners are because Mach3 is running in G64 mode.
